  • The major purpose of this study is to show exact and convenient devices and minimize error in body measurement. This study was referred to 13 records and compared 6 items that the investigator's opinion has been differed about anthropometric point and line and suggested convenient and radical device, and measured by if need be. The 30 students from 20 to 25 ages were measured and data was analyzed by mean, std. deviation and paired t-test. The results are as follows. 1. Side neck point has been suggested many devices, but was suggested in this study to decide by M. trapezius, cervicale point and fossa jugularis point. 2. Shoulder point was suggested to decide by point of 1/2 armhole depth, upper arm depth and shoulder depth except acromion point. 3. Waist circumference line has been differed between horizontal line and natural line. The result of measurements was no significant difference between two methods and natural line was convenience. Waist circumference line must considered two methods together for garment construction and somato type. 4. The standard of hip circumference line has been differed between buttock point and trochanterion point. The result of measurements was significant difference between two methods, but two point must considered together because of body type. 5. Chest circumference line at scye has been differed between horizontal line and natural line. The result of measurements was significant difference between two methods and natural line was convenience. Chest circumference line at scye must studied to decide method the line for garment construction.

  • The fatty acids content of castor (Ricinus communis L.) seed oil is 80-90% ricinoleic acid, which is a hydroxy fatty acid (HFA). The structures and functional groups of HFAs are different from those of common fatty acids and are useful for various industrial applications. However, castor seeds contain the toxin ricin and an allergenic protein, which limit their cultivation. Accordingly, many researchers are conducting studies to enhance the production of HFAs in Arabidopsis thaliana, a model plant for oil crops. Oleate 12-hydroxylase from castor (RcFAH12), which synthesizes HFA (18:1-OH), was transformed into an Arabidopsis fae1 mutant, resulting in the CL37 line producing a maximum of 17% HFA content. In addition, castor phospholipid:diacylglycerol acyltransferase 1-2 (RcPDAT1-2), which catalyzes the production of triacylglycerol by transferring HFA from phosphatidylcholine to diacylglycerol, was transformed into the CL37 line to develop a P327 line that produces 25% HFA. In this study, we investigated changes in HFA content when endogenous Arabidopsis PDAT1 (AtPDAT1) of the P327 line was edited using the CRISPR/Cas9 technique. The successful mutation resulted in three independent lines with different mutation patterns, which were transmitted until the T4 generation. Fatty acid analysis of the seeds showed that HFA content decreased in all three mutant lines. These findings indicate that AtPDAT1 as well as RcPDAT1-2 in the P327 line are involved in transferring and increasing HFAs to triacylglycerol.

  • This experimental study was carried out to evaluate the effect of Yipahnsan on angiogenic inhibition mechanism. This study investigates the effects of Yipahnsan on angiogenic inhibition mechanism evaluate cell adhesive inhibition effect, DNA fragmantaion analysis, nuclear condensation assay, FACScan analysis, angiogenic lumen formation assay, immunocytochemistry analysis, RT-PCR for mRNA expression, western blot analysis, confocal analysis for $Ca^{2+}influx$. The results were summarized as follows : 1. The cell adhesive inhibition ability was strongly increased from $5{\mu}g/ml$ on ECV304 cell line and ECVPAR cell line. 2. YY water extract caused $G_0/G_1$ arrest peak to existed on the ECV304 cell line. 3. YY water extract caused inhibition of proliferation and inducement of apoptosis on the collagen coated plate in ECV304 cell line. 4. YY water extract inhibited the lumen formation on the matrigel coated plate in ECV304 cell line. 5. YY water extract inhibited the expressions of LFA-1 and ELAM-1 on ECV304 cell line and ECVPAR cell line. 6. YY water extract inhibited the expressions of MMP-9 and uPA on ECV304 cell line and ECVPAR cell line. 7. YY water extract inhibited the expression of integrin ${\alpha}_v{\beta}_3$ on ECV304 cell line and ECVPAR cell line. 8. YY water extract decreased the change of $Ca^{2+}$ in intracellular on ECV304 cell line and ECVPAR cell line. According to the results, Yipahnsan showed to be a key antagonist of integrin ${\alpha}_v{\beta}_3$, and to be induction of apoptosis by p53 through flow cytometry. This report also demonstrated that expressions of MMP-9 and uPA were blocked under the angiogenesis model. Thus, we suggested that Yipahnsan blocks angiogenesis by inducing apoptosis in ECV304 and ECVPAR cell lines, and another oriental herbal medicine that treats qi-stagnation and blood-stasis type also has angiogenic inhibition effects.

  • The purpose of this study was to determine the effect of finish line design, amount of incisal reduction, and loading condition on the stress distribution in anterior all-ceramic crowns. Three-dimensional finite element models of an incisor all-ceramic crown with 3 different finish line designs : 1) shoulder with sharp line angle 2) shoulder with rounded line angle 3) chamfer : and 2 different incisal reductions : 2mm and 4mm were developed. 300 N force with the direction of 45 degree to the long axis of the tooth was applied at 3 different positions : A) incisal 1/3, B) incisal edge, C) cervical 1/5. Stresses developed in ceramic and cement were analyzed using three-dimensional finite element method. The results were as follows : 1. Stresses were concentrated in the margin region, which were primarily compressive in the labial and tensile in the lingual. 2. Stresses were larger in the area near line angle than on the crown surface of the margin region. In case of shoulder with sharp line angle, stresses were highly concentrated in the porcelain near line angle. 3. At the interface between porcelain and cement and at the porcelain above the margin on crown surface, stresses were the highest in chamfer, and decreased in shoulder with sharp line angle and shoulder with rounded line angle, respectively. 4. At the interface between cement and abutment on crown surface, stresses were the highest in shoulder with sharp line angle, and decreased in shoulder with rounded line angle and chamfer, respectively. 5. The amount of incisal reduction had little influence on the stress distribution in all-ceramic crowns. 6. When load was applied at the incisal edge, higher stresses were developed in the margin region and the incisal edge than under the other loading conditions. 7. When load was applied at the cervical 1/5, stresses were very low as a whole.

  • The purpose of this study is to build and manage environment models with line segments from sonar range data on obstacles in unknown and varied environments. The proposed method therefore employs a two-stage data-transform process in order to extract environmental line segments from range data on obstacles. In the first stage, the occupancy grid extracted from the range data is accumulated to form a two-dimensional local histogram grid. In the second stage, a line histogram extracted from a local histogram grid is based on a Hough transform, and matching serves as a means of comparing each of the segments on a global line segments map against the line segments to detect the degree of similarity in the overlap, orientation, and arrangement. Each of these tests is formulated by comparing one of the parameters in the segment representation. After the tests, new line segments can be found at maximum-density cells in the line histogram, and they are composed onto the global line segment map. The proposed technique is demonstrated in experiments in an indoor environment.

  • This paper proposes a dual band branch line coupler (BLC) using a composite right/left handed (CRLH) transmission line. The existing dual band BLCs with open stubs require hundreds of line impedance for the open stub as the frequency bands approach to each other, so it has been almost impossible to realize them. However in the proposed BLC, a CRLH transmission line replaces the open stub with an extremely high line impedance so that the BLC circuit may be realized even two frequencies are close to each other. As an example, a dual band BLC operating at 1800MHz and 2300MHz (the frequency ratio is 1:1.28) is designed and measured. Open stubs with $560\Omega$ line impedance are replaced by CRLH transmission lines for realizing the dual band BLC. The measured performances prove that the dual band operation is well acceptable and the proposed design method is successful even the ratio between two frequencies is not around two nor more.

  • Purpose: To assess the relationship between soft tissue reference line and hard tissue reference line using the standardized photographs and the posteroanterior cephalometric radiographs(P-A)in facial asymmetric patients and to compare the differences of angular measurement between normal group and asymmetry group. Methods: Normal group consisted of 44 persons with normal occlusion and normal facial morphology. Asymmetry group consisted of 90 patients with facial asymmetry. Standardized facial photographs and P-A were taken in all subjects. The horizontal reference lines were bipupillary line in photographs and latero-orbitale line in P-A respectively. The vertical reference line were the line from the midpoint of horizontal reference line perpendicularly. Angular measurement of otobasion canting, lip canting, nose deviation, chin deviation, and maxillary deviation were compared and analyzed in photographs. And angular measurement of mastoid canting, mandibular canting, nose deviation, chin deviation, and maxillary deviation were compared and analyzed in P-A. Results: 1. The variables of photographs and P-A were significantly related in the asymmetry group. 2. Significant differences between all variables except for PT2 and PA2 were shown in the asymmetry group and between PT1 and PA1, PT3 and PA3 in the normal group respectively. 3. Comparison measurement scores of angular difference between control group and experimental group concerning each variable showed significant difference except for PA1. Conclusions: Soft tissue components may not compensate for underlying skeletal imbalance in nose deviation and chin deviation. The horizontal reference lines in photographs were significant related with the P-A, but angular variables between the two studies show significant differences. Therefore, we do not recommend use photography in the assessment the facial asymmetry as complemented in the P-A.
